Runner On The I & M Canal Tow Path Beaten By A Dirt Bike Operator

The Illinois Department of Natural Resources Conservation Police and Will County Forrest Preserve Police are investigating an incident that occurred on the I and M canal tow path in Channahon on Tuesday evening.

WJOL learned yesterday that a male runner and a man in his 20’s, who was riding a dirt bike, got into an altercation on the path. The runner was allegedly battered by the dirt biker operator, who then fled the scene.

The runner was taken to an area hospital with non life threatening injuries. The dirt bike rider was wearing a black helmet and was riding a green dirt bike. A screenshot of the dirt bike operator has been released, but police have no other information..
